Failure?

This is a true year 11 MacRob story.  


About this time of the year, some years ago, I had a meeting with a year 11 student, her mother, father and brother in one of the Consultation Rooms near the Hall. Yes, the whole family!  For about 30 minutes, there were tears and sorrow from the whole family. The reason?  The student did not receive a General Excellence Award that year.  She had received that award in year 9 and 10 and in her previous school in years 7 and 8.  The family thought she was a failure and that she had brought disgrace upon them. Statistically, she had ended up as #14 that year ... that was not good enough for the family!  Anyway, the last time I spoke to this student, a few years ago, she had just completed first year medicine at Monash, her first preference, and she was happy and content.
